Advertisement

Python利用wordcloud制作美观的中文词云及源码分享

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本篇文章将介绍如何使用Python和WordCloud库来创建美观且具有视觉冲击力的中文词云,并分享详细的代码示例。适合对数据可视化感兴趣的读者学习参考。 在Python中使用wordcloud库可以生成漂亮的中文词云资源。此外还可以查看相应的源码以便更好地理解和应用这个功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Pythonwordcloud
    优质
    本篇文章将介绍如何使用Python和WordCloud库来创建美观且具有视觉冲击力的中文词云,并分享详细的代码示例。适合对数据可视化感兴趣的读者学习参考。 在Python中使用wordcloud库可以生成漂亮的中文词云资源。此外还可以查看相应的源码以便更好地理解和应用这个功能。
  • Pythonwordcloud和jieba国地图
    优质
    本项目运用Python编程语言结合wordcloud与jieba库,成功创建了一幅基于地理位置分布的中国地图词云图,直观展现文本数据中词汇的重要性和频率。 热词图非常吸引人,并且非常适合用于热点事件的展示。它能够抓住重点内容并通过图文结合的方式呈现出来,具有很强的表现力。 下面是一段用来制作热词图的代码,使用了以下技术: - jieba:进行文本分词。 - wordcloud:生成热词云图。 - chardet:自动识别文件编码格式,其中中文统一为GB18030以确保兼容性。 - imageio:提取图片形状。 此外,该代码还能够自动识别txt文件的编码,并且图片和对应的文本段落件名称一致。使用的数据集是四大名著(具体可以自行搜索)以及部分中国地图信息。以下是相关代码: ```python import os import jieba import wordcloud import chardet import imageio directory = D: ``` 注意:上述目录路径为示例,实际使用时需要根据实际情况进行调整。
  • 使Python进行
    优质
    本教程详细介绍如何利用Python实现高效的中文文本处理,涵盖使用Jieba库进行精确、全面的中文分词,并结合WordCloud库制作美观实用的词云图。适合数据可视化和自然语言处理爱好者学习实践。 通过窗体选择文本段落件并绘制词云图文件,可以自行设定词云的词汇数量及字体大小。
  • Python、jieba和wordcloud生成效果
    优质
    本项目运用Python编程语言结合jieba分词库与wordcloud插件,实现高效精准的文字处理及美观的词云图像生成,提供数据可视化的新视角。 前言:突然想做一个漏洞词云,以了解哪些类型的漏洞出现频率较高,并且如果某些厂商有公开的漏洞(比如某公司),也可以有针对性地进行挖掘研究。于是选择了x云作为数据来源。通过使用jieba和wordcloud这两个强大的第三方库,可以轻松制作出基于x云的数据集的漏洞词云图。 代码实现部分直接展示如下: ```python #coding:utf-8 #作者:LSA #描述:为wooyun生成词云 #日期: ``` 注意这里仅展示了爬取标题的部分功能和开始编码,后续还有更多内容如数据处理及可视化等步骤。
  • 指南(wordcloud与pyecharts)
    优质
    本指南深入讲解如何使用Python库wordcloud和pyecharts来创建美观且富有信息量的词云图。适合数据可视化爱好者学习参考。 使用wordcloud和pyecharts中的WordCloud方法可以创建词云图。
  • 使jieba和wordcloud库在Python创建
    优质
    本教程介绍如何利用Python的jieba和wordcloud库来处理中文文本并生成美观的词云图,适用于初学者快速上手。 代码如下: ```python import wordcloud import jieba font = rC:\Windows\Fonts\simfang.ttf w = wordcloud.WordCloud(height=700, width=1000, font_path=font, stopwords=[et, al, Crampin, and, the, Liu], max_words=30) with open(NSFC.txt, r) as f: txt = f.read() txt = .join(jieba.lcut(txt)) ```
  • WordCloud
    优质
    《词云》是一款直观展示文本数据中关键词分布与频率的应用程序。通过可视化技术将大量文字信息转化为美观且富有洞察力的艺术图形,帮助用户迅速掌握文档的核心内容和主题趋势。 wordcloud是一个常用的云图包,在统计绘图中经常使用,可以直接通过pip安装。
  • Python创建Wordcloud例子
    优质
    本教程详细介绍了使用Python编程语言和其库(如wordcloud)来创建美观的词云图的过程,适合对数据可视化感兴趣的初学者。 本段落主要介绍了如何使用Python生成词云图的示例,并通过详细的代码示例进行了讲解。这些内容对于学习或工作中需要创建词云图的人来说具有一定的参考价值,希望对大家有所帮助。
  • 使wordcloud、jieba和matplotlib在Python创建
    优质
    本教程将指导您如何利用Python中的WordCloud库、结巴分词(jieba)及Matplotlib进行中文文本分析,并生成美观且富有信息量的词云图。 从txt文本里提取关键词并生成词云的案例基于Python 3.6,相关模块如下: - `wordcloud`:根据其名称可以推断出这是本例的核心模块,它将带权重的关键字渲染成词云。 - `matplotlib`:绘图库,用于展示由`wordcloud`生成的图片。 - `numpy`:图像处理库,读取并操作像素矩阵。 - `PIL (pip install pillow)`:用于打开和初始化图片的图像处理模块。 - `jieba`:强大的中文分词工具。由于本案例是从一个txt文本中提取关键词,因此需要使用`jieba`进行分词,并统计词频。如果已经有现成的数据,则无需此步骤。 以上所有库均可通过pip安装命令直接安装。